About Tara Donahue

My passion is working with clients to assess their needs, develop strategic technical assistance plans to help them achieve their goals, and implement action plans for continuous program improvement.Over the past two decades, I have served as an evaluator, professional development/technical assistance provider, and researcher in multiple capacities, primarily across the PreK-12 and post-secondary education sector. I have worked on diverse projects including capacity-building across state education agencies, college and career readiness, communities of practice/networked improvement communities/collective impact, early childhood education, arts integration, English as a Second Language, extended learning/out-of-school time, family engagement, professional development, comprehensive school reform, STEM, teacher preparation, and workforce development, More recently I have served as a federal contractor for the Department of Education. Projects include the National Assessment Governing Board and Regional Advisory Committees. Other professional responsibilities include business development. I have been involved with the entire process, beginning with the capture process through writing the proposal and pricing. Highlights from my career:• Provided technical assistance and evaluation support to three Comprehensive Centers and multiple grantees, including 21st Century Community Learning Center grantees• Developed, conducted, analyzed, and reported results for interviews, focus groups, classroom observations, surveys, and fidelity of implementation instruments across projects and clients• Drafted over 50 external evaluation reports for federal and state agencies, non-profit organizations, and Institutes of Higher Education including reports for U.S. Department of Education and U.S. Department of Labor grants, such as Teacher Quality Partnership, Supporting Effective Educator Development, National Professional Development, and Trade Adjustment and Assistance Community College and Career Training grants• Authored a Regional Educational Laboratory research report• Demonstrate positive client relationships as evidenced by over 10 years of providing evaluation services across three grants for Old Dominion University• Facilitated over 30 trainings, workshops, and presentations at national conferences• Authored or co-authored over 20 published manuscripts• Have managed portfolios of approximately $2,000,000• Led or collaborated on business development efforts totally approximately $3,000,000
